AI Summary

  • Creates a student loan repayment assistance program for Texas-licensed attorneys employed as prosecuting attorneys in the border prosecution unit established under Chapter 772, Government Code

  • Eligible attorneys can receive 25% of their total student loan balance repaid for each consecutive year of service, up to a maximum of four years of assistance

  • Caps individual loan repayment assistance at $110,000 total per attorney, with a program-wide limit of $2 million per state fiscal biennium

  • Covers student loans from accredited institutions of higher education (including undergraduate loans) from any lender, but excludes loans in default at the time of application

  • Requires the Texas Higher Education Coordinating Board to adopt rules, distribute program information to law schools and border prosecution unit offices, and maximize available matching funds from other sources

Legislative Description

Relating to student loan repayment assistance for certain prosecuting attorneys who are employed as part of the border prosecution unit.
